Week 2 of Workouts

I have finally established some sort of a work-out routine.  I'm still only going three times a week, but I've increased the amount of walking and bike riding that I do at home with the girls.  As my joints stop hurting, I plan on going to the gym more often.  Until my partially torn shoulder and C5 and C6 are rehabilitated to the point that I'm not in agony, I'm not going to push myself in order to lose the weight for surgery.


So, in an attempt to stay motivated, I found a great way to continue my focus while in the pool.  I was having a difficult time keeping with my laps.  I can't do as many as I would like because of the stupid shoulder and neck problems, and I found that I was spending way too much time focusing on the pain and the laps themselves.  While I was working out in the gym, I didn't have this problem, and I realized that it was because of my iPod.  The solution was the H2O Audio Solutions.  


www.h2oaudio.com


Here's my new purchase:



I found the H2O Audio System and it was half off because I have the 2nd generation Shuffle.  Totally cool!  of course, Amazon offers a discount on a related item, so I HAD to get the Speedo goggles with Anti-fog.  I thought it was too much for me, but swimming without the goggles fogging up today was AWESOME!   Not to mention, I got through my 6 laps without realizing that I was doing 6 laps.  I was done in half of the time because I didn't have to stop and "rest" my shoulder, etc.  I just grooved with the tunes and enjoyed myself.  


Now, these systems were given to Olympic swimmers to play with.  The one I was using was used by Natalie Coughlin - who, I must admit, I did not even know her name until I was looking at this system.  Here's a great picture of the audio system in use:



The controls are on the back of your head.  You can use the Shuffle as you normally would even under water.  I was able to turn the volume both up and down and it did not move while I was in the water.  I am not using a hat, so I have the entire setup on the back of my head, but I am now the envy of all the swimmers at our local gym.  Whoo-hoo!


So, I will continue with my weight loss goal.  While there has been no major change in my size, I am finding that I have more energy than I used to, and my clothes are fitting better.  There is still a ways to go, but I'm getting in the groove.
